3 Reasons Why Homeowners Need To Use Commercial Painters

A great way to give a room a makeover is to apply a fresh coat of paint. However, you may be pressed for time and might not have access to the right tools. That's perfectly okay because you can always hire commercial painters. These professionals offer many advantages as opposed to DIY painting. 

Extensive Prep Work 

Perhaps the most taxing part about painting a home is the massive prep work involved. You may not have time for any of it. Commercial painters do and have efficient methods to speed up this entire process. 

They'll put large protective covers over your important and fragile possessions, including furniture, paintings, electronics, and floors. They'll also prime, sand, and clean each wall to ensure the paint applied sticks without any trouble. 

If there are any gaps between the walls and baseboards, caulk is administered for a seamless look. Lastly, any areas not receiving paint are marked off. You'll have a peace of mind from start to finish.

Enhanced Safety 

Even though painting may seem fun, there are a lot of inherent dangers you have to be careful of. Commercial painters are trained extensively to handle any potential safety hazards that might be present. They'll take the necessary safety precautions, such as removing sources of ignition and opening up windows and doors to provide better ventilation. 

They also have access to specialized painting gear that shields them from danger. For example, full-body suits and heavy-duty coveralls provide maximum skin protection throughout the painting job. They will even wear half-mask respirators that protect them from any toxic fumes or particles circulating throughout the area. 

Fully Licensed and Insured 

No matter what precautions are taken, accidents to your property are sometimes unavoidable. At least when you get help from commercial painters who are licensed and insured, you can rest assured you won't be responsible for any costs if damages do occur.

The insurance provides a security blanket, while the license certifies professional, high-quality work. The commercial painter went through the proper channels and education to receive their license, which ultimately benefits you as the consumer because you won't have to worry as much about insufficient work.
